Skip to main content

A simple handler for configuration files detailing genomic datasets

Project description

Getting Started with genomic-config

version: 0.1.5

The genomic-config package provides an interface to configuration files that provide the locations for various genomic based files that might exist on a system. It can be used by external programs and Python code to provide a central point to locate the files. Currently, it only supports ini files but will be expanded to incorporate other configuration file types in the future.

genomic-config provides access to:

  1. Reference genome assemblies (fasta files)
  2. Reference genotype files (i.e. 1000 genomes)
  3. Chain files for liftovers
  4. Sample lists
  5. variant annotation/mapping VCF files
  6. mappings between chromosome synonyms
  7. Providing access to a chromosome sort order

There is online documentation.

Installation instructions

Can be installed using either pip or conda.

Using pip:

pip install genomic-config

Using conda:

conda install -c cfin -c bioconda genomic-config

Next steps...

If you have cloned the repository, after installation, you may want to run the tests:

  1. Run the tests using pytest ./tests - If you have installed using conda, you will need to clone the repository using git to run the tests.
  2. Setup your configuration file.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

genomic_config-0.1.5.tar.gz (90.1 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

genomic_config-0.1.5-py3-none-any.whl (91.7 kB view details)

Uploaded Python 3

File details

Details for the file genomic_config-0.1.5.tar.gz.

File metadata

  • Download URL: genomic_config-0.1.5.tar.gz
  • Upload date:
  • Size: 90.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.13.0

File hashes

Hashes for genomic_config-0.1.5.tar.gz
Algorithm Hash digest
SHA256 ccb70295350e5d31a0078327d830306bbb9f5e92f10676d2dc634b7899079159
MD5 52ee3f7be06af0978ac795ddb792c4e1
BLAKE2b-256 ab3ca763a2c70eb00ee55a4f68b86e578504fff2853d1aa42c5d155cf356bbbb

See more details on using hashes here.

File details

Details for the file genomic_config-0.1.5-py3-none-any.whl.

File metadata

  • Download URL: genomic_config-0.1.5-py3-none-any.whl
  • Upload date:
  • Size: 91.7 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.13.0

File hashes

Hashes for genomic_config-0.1.5-py3-none-any.whl
Algorithm Hash digest
SHA256 b62f394c82dbf5ef58b6024fc931287982369ee8749373118dd7fb41614895bb
MD5 9e7f997e3512a0572866cf590b666708
BLAKE2b-256 dee03ce10eff6bcdf3233d27df4114d9c5eea6874e5a6aed0900425b3648a012

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page